1. The Crown: Immerse yourself in the world of British royalty with “The Crown.” This historical drama series not only provides a captivating storyline but also offers rich, formal English dialogue. Engage with the language of diplomacy, politics, and elegance.

2. Stranger Things: Dive into the supernatural mysteries of Hawkins, Indiana, with “Stranger Things.” This popular series is perfect for understanding colloquial American English, especially slang and everyday conversations among teenagers.

3. The Office (US): Laugh and learn with the employees of Dunder Mifflin Paper Company in “The Office.” This mockumentary-style sitcom showcases various accents, workplace jargon, and casual conversations, making it an excellent resource for everyday English phrases and office-related vocabulary.

4. The Great British Baking Show: Indulge your sweet tooth while enhancing your language skills with “The Great British Baking Show.” This delightful series offers clear, concise English narration, allowing you to pick up culinary terms and phrases effortlessly.

5. Sherlock: Sharpen your detective skills with “Sherlock.” This modern adaptation of Sir Arthur Conan Doyle’s classic detective stories offers fast-paced dialogue, complex vocabulary, and British wit, providing a linguistic challenge for advanced learners.

How to Learn While Watching:

  1. Use Subtitles Wisely: Start with English subtitles to understand the dialogue better. As you progress, switch to subtitles in your native language, and eventually, challenge yourself by turning them off completely.
  2. Take Notes: Jot down new words or phrases you hear. Look them up, understand their meanings, and try using them in your own sentences.
  3. Repeat Dialogues: Pause and rewind scenes with complex dialogue. Repeat the sentences aloud to practice pronunciation and intonation.
  4. Discuss Episodes: Engage in discussions about the episodes with fellow English learners or native speakers. Explaining what you’ve watched in English enhances your conversational skills.
